What Causes QuickBooks Script Errors?

A QuickBooks Script Error isn’t actually a bug within the software itself. Instead, it’s caused by a conflict between QuickBooks Desktop and the underlying Internet Explorer (IE) settings. Yes, even today, QuickBooks relies on Internet Explorer for rendering web-based components. When something goes wrong in that layer, a script error shows up.

Here are the most common causes:

  1. Corrupt or outdated Internet Explorer settings
  2. Improperly configured ActiveX controls
  3. Security restrictions or antivirus interference
  4. Accumulated cache and browsing history
  5. Conflicting or unnecessary browser add-ons

How to Fix QuickBooks Script Error

To get back on track, follow these proven steps:

  1. Clear Cache and Temporary Internet Files
    • Open Internet Explorer.
    • Go to ⚙️ Settings → Internet Options → General tab.
    • Under Browsing History, click Delete. Make sure to check Temporary Internet Files and Cookies.
  2. Disable Add-ons
    • Press Alt + XManage Add-ons
    • Disable unnecessary or unfamiliar extensions.
  3. Reset Internet Explorer Settings
    • Navigate to the Advanced tab in Internet Options.
    • Click Reset and confirm.
    • Restart your computer for changes to take effect.
  4. Update JavaScript and ActiveX Controls
    • Make sure all relevant components are updated.

  5. Make Internet Explorer the Default Browser
    • Even if you primarily use Chrome or Edge, QuickBooks requires IE as the default in some operations.
    • Go to Control Panel → Default Programs → Set IE as default.
  6. Temporarily Disable Antivirus/Firewall
    • Sometimes security software blocks scripts. Pause your antivirus, then try again.
    • If the issue disappears, whitelist QuickBooks.
